Hair Follicle
Invagination of the epidermis into the dermis; contains the root of the hair and receives the ducts of sebaceous and apocrine glands.
Sebaceous Glands
Small oil-producing glands in the skin that secrete sebum into hair follicles to lubricate the skin and hair.
Adipose Tissue
A type of connective tissue that stores energy in the form of fat, provides insulation, and supports and protects organs.
Subcutaneous Layer
The layer of tissue directly under the skin, composed of fat and connective tissues that insulate and protect the body.
